HomeStreet (HMST) Reports Q2 Loss, Tops Revenue Estimates
ZACKS· 2025-07-28 23:20
Company Performance - HomeStreet reported a quarterly loss of $0.16 per share, which was worse than the Zacks Consensus Estimate of a loss of $0.05, representing an earnings surprise of -420.00% [1] - The company posted revenues of $48.97 million for the quarter ended June 2025, surpassing the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 0.87%, and showing an increase from $42.93 million year-over-year [2] - Over the last four quarters, HomeStreet has not been able to surpass consensus EPS estimates, although it has topped consensus revenue estimates twice [2] Stock Outlook - HomeStreet shares have increased by approximately 16% since the beginning of the year, outperforming the S&P 500's gain of 8.6% [3] - The company's earnings outlook, including current consensus earnings expectations for upcoming quarters, will be crucial for investors [4] - The current consensus EPS estimate for the coming quarter is $0.12 on $50 million in revenues, and $0.16 on $194.65 million in revenues for the current fiscal year [7] Industry Context - The Financial - Savings and Loan industry, to which HomeStreet belongs, is currently in the bottom 30% of over 250 Zacks industries, indicating potential challenges ahead [8] - Empirical research suggests a strong correlation between near-term stock movements and trends in earnings estimate revisions, which can impact HomeStreet's stock performance [5][6]

AGNC Investment: After Another Tough Quarter, Can the Stock Maintain Its Dividend?
The Motley Fool· 2025-07-26 22:10
Core Viewpoint - The mortgage-backed security (MBS) market remains challenging due to ongoing tariff issues and tensions between President Trump and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ell, impacting AGNC Investment's performance despite a high dividend yield of over 15% [1] Market Environment - AGNC primarily holds MBS backed by government-sponsored agencies like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, which are generally considered low-risk due to their government backing [2] - Interest rates significantly affect MBS values, with yields trading at a spread to U.S. Treasury yields, which are viewed as safe [3] - Regulatory tightening has led banks to avoid longer-duration assets like MBS, contributing to market pressure [3] Company Performance - AGNC reported a 5% decline in tangible book value (TBV) to $7.81 per share at the end of Q2, down from $8.25 per share at the end of Q1, but noted a 1% increase in July after accounting for dividends [6] - The average net interest spread for AGNC was 2.01%, down from 2.69% a year ago and 2.12% in Q1, attributed to reduced benefits from hedges and increased hedge costs [7] - AGNC generated $0.38 per share in net spread and income from dollar rolls, resulting in a negative 1% economic return on tangible common equity [8] Leverage and Capital Deployment - The company ended the quarter with a leverage ratio of 7.6 times tangible net book value, slightly up from 7.5 at the end of Q1 [9] - AGNC raised $800 million in equity through its ATM program at a premium to TBV, with plans to invest the proceeds gradually [10] Future Outlook - AGNC expects net spread and dollar roll income to remain in the mid- to high-$0.30 to low- to mid-$0.40 range, which should support its dividend [12] - The company requires tighter MBS spreads for TBV improvement, as current wide spreads can be beneficial for investment returns but need to narrow for stock appreciation [13] - With MBS spreads near historical highs, the stock may be attractive for risk-tolerant, income-oriented investors, although the current price reflects some of this potential [14]

Invesco Mortgage Capital Inc. Reports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results
Prnewswire· 2025-07-24 20:15
Core Viewpoint - Invesco Mortgage Capital Inc. reported a challenging second quarter in 2025, with a significant economic return of (4.8)%, driven by market volatility and a decline in book value per share, despite maintaining a consistent dividend payout. Financial Performance - The company experienced a net loss attributable to common stockholders of $26.6 million, translating to a loss per share of $0.40, compared to a net income of $16.3 million and earnings per share of $0.26 in Q1 2025 [10][11]. - Total interest income decreased to $70.6 million from $73.8 million in Q1 2025, while total interest expense also fell to $52.9 million from $55.0 million, resulting in a net interest income of $17.7 million, down from $18.8 million [9][10]. - The average earning assets at amortized cost decreased to $5,078.9 million from $5,422.6 million, and average borrowings also declined to $4,577.6 million from $4,930.2 million [9]. Portfolio and Valuation - As of June 30, 2025, the company’s investment portfolio was valued at $5.2 billion, comprising $4.3 billion in Agency RMBS and $0.9 billion in Agency CMBS, with a debt-to-equity ratio of 6.5x, down from 7.1x at the end of Q1 2025 [3][10]. - The estimated book value per common share as of July 18, 2025, is projected to be between $7.99 and $8.31, reflecting a cautious near-term outlook for Agency RMBS but a favorable long-term outlook due to expected investor demand [4][10]. Dividends and Capital Activities - The company declared a common stock dividend of $0.34 per share, consistent with the previous quarter, to be paid on July 25, 2025 [22]. - During the quarter, the company sold 282,750 shares of common stock for net cash proceeds of $2.2 million and repurchased 96,803 shares of Series C Preferred Stock for $2.3 million [23][24]. Economic Return and Non-GAAP Measures - The economic return for the quarter was calculated as the change in book value per common share of ($0.76) plus dividends declared of $0.34, resulting in an economic return of (4.8)%, compared to a positive return of 2.6% in Q1 2025 [6][10]. - Earnings available for distribution per common share decreased to $0.58 from $0.64 in Q1 2025, indicating a decline in the company’s ability to generate income for distribution [10][43].
Orchid Island Capital Announces Second Quarter 2025 Results
Globenewswire· 2025-07-24 20:05
Core Insights - Orchid Island Capital, Inc. reported a net loss of $33.6 million for the second quarter of 2025, compared to a net loss of $5.0 million in the same period of 2024, indicating significant financial challenges [6][7][8] - The company experienced a turbulent market environment influenced by reciprocal tariffs and the passage of the One Big Beautiful Bill Act, which shifted market focus from trade to domestic issues [4][5] - Despite the overall market recovery, the Agency RMBS sector did not fully recover, leading to negative excess returns for the quarter [5][6] Financial Performance - The interest income on the portfolio increased by approximately $11.2 million from the first quarter of 2025 [6] - The yield on average Agency RMBS decreased slightly from 5.41% in Q1 2025 to 5.38% in Q2 2025 [6] - The company declared and paid dividends of $0.36 per common share during the second quarter [7] Balance Sheet and Capital Allocation - As of June 30, 2025, the book value per common share was $7.21, down from a decrease of $0.73 per share during the quarter [7][25] - The company maintained a strong liquidity position with $492.5 million in cash and cash equivalents, representing approximately 54% of stockholders' equity [7][13] - The total mortgage assets increased to $6.993 billion as of June 30, 2025, compared to $5.253 billion at the end of 2024 [10][47] Portfolio Characteristics - The company allocated approximately 98.1% of its investable capital to the PT RMBS portfolio as of June 30, 2025 [26] - The return on invested capital for the PT RMBS portfolio was approximately (4.1)%, while the structured RMBS portfolio generated a return of 3.5% [32][33] Market Conditions and Strategy - The company faced challenges in the Agency RMBS market, which continued to experience volatility and did not recover fully from the turmoil earlier in the quarter [5][6] - The management believes that the company is well-positioned to capture attractive returns in the current market environment [5]
Alexander & Baldwin, Inc. Reports Second Quarter 2025 Results
Prnewswire· 2025-07-24 20:05
Core Insights - Alexander & Baldwin, Inc. reported a net income of $25.1 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, for Q2 2025, a significant increase from $9.1 million, or $0.13 per diluted share, in Q2 2024 [1][4][19] - The company raised its guidance for 2025, reflecting confidence in its high-quality portfolio and internal growth strategy [3][14] Financial Performance - The company achieved a Commercial Real Estate (CRE) operating profit of $22.2 million for Q2 2025, compared to $22.6 million in Q2 2024 [4][19] - Funds From Operations (FFO) were reported at $35.2 million, or $0.48 per diluted share, up from $20.6 million, or $0.28 per diluted share, in the same quarter last year [4][29] - Same-Store Net Operating Income (NOI) grew by 5.3% year-over-year, reaching $32.7 million [6][8][27] Leasing and Occupancy - The total leased occupancy rate as of June 30, 2025, was 95.8%, an increase from 93.9% a year earlier [11] - The company executed 52 improved-property leases for approximately 183,800 square feet, generating $6.1 million in annualized base rent [9] - Comparable blended leasing spreads for the improved portfolio were 6.8%, with retail spaces at 7.4% and industrial spaces at 4.7% [9] Investment and Development Activities - The company began pre-construction of two new buildings at Komohana Industrial Park, which will add 105,000 square feet of Gross Leasable Area (GLA) [8][18] - Construction is ongoing for a 29,550-square-foot warehouse and distribution center at Maui Business Park, expected to be operational in Q1 2026 [18] Balance Sheet and Liquidity - As of June 30, 2025, the company had total liquidity of $307.6 million, including $8.6 million in cash and $299 million available on its revolving line of credit [18] - The net debt to trailing twelve months (TTM) Consolidated Adjusted EBITDA ratio was 3.3 times, with TTM Consolidated Adjusted EBITDA of $135.6 million [18] Dividend Information - The company paid a dividend of $0.2250 per share for Q2 2025 and declared the same amount for Q3 2025, payable on October 7, 2025 [18]
